The size of Adamstown is approximately 3.0 square kilometres. It has 8 parks covering nearly 31.2% of total area. The population of Adamstown in 2016 was 6044 people. By 2021 the population was 6335 showing a population growth of 4.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Adamstown is 20-29 years. Households in Adamstown are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Adamstown work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 58.00% of the homes in Adamstown were owner-occupied compared with 57.70% in 2016.
